Changing button layout for a single mechanic by josiah_holla in RocketLeagueSchool

[–]syphiexe 0 points1 point  (0 children)

If your in gold and you have that many mechanics but haven't ranked up, it's not your mechanics that are lacking. In gold I didn't know how to half flip I just relied on my teammate to know when I'm passing so they could score, I only learned some of those fancy mechanics when I started practicing recovery, recovery mechanics got me into diamond and not once have I EVER needed to chain wave dash, I know how to do it, but if you keep your momentum up you should be good. If your comfortable with your settings now I wouldn't change them for one mechanic that might look cool but you'll never use.
